New banknotes exchange for Dashain from Oct 2: Nepal Rastra Bank

KATHMANDU: As the biggest Nepali festival Dashain is just round the corner, the Nepal Rastra Bank is preparing to open the service to exchange new banknotes from October 2.

The central bank said on Wednesday the members of general public can exchange as much as Rs 37,000 each from its Currency Management Division.

Exchange service would be available from the other branches of NRB and other banks also.

Personnel from Nepal Army, Nepal Police and Armed Police Force and civil servants can get more notes upon submitting an official document, as per the availability, the NRB said in a statement.

According to the NRB, banks graded 'A', 'B' and 'C' as well as other financial institutions can exchange notes from the bank's Thapathali-based CMD from September 25 to 30.

The BFIs have been directed to use the notes to let members of the public exchange their cashes with local banks and branches from October 2.

Banks and their branches outside the Valley have also been directed to provide the services.
